AITO accumulates 265 million kilometers of intelligent driving distance

The cumulative intelligent driving distance of AITO vehicles has reached 265 million kilometers, with a daily increase of approximately 2.35 million kilometers.

Beijing (Gasgoo)- Recently, Mr. Zhang Xinghai, Chairman and Founder of Seres Group (SERES), delivered a keynote speech at the World Intelligence Expo 2024. He disclosed that to date, the cumulative intelligent driving distance of AITO vehicles has reached 265 million kilometers, with a daily increase of approximately 2.35 million kilometers.

According to recent data, SERES has completed 1.4 million OTA updates for its users, with updates occurring every five days. Currently, all AITO vehicles produced by SERES feature driving assistance functions, with two-thirds equipped with advanced intelligent driving capabilities, placing them at the forefront of the industry.

Three years ago, SERES began its cross-industry integration with ICT giant Huawei, collaborating on design and business operations to bring the market-approved AITO M5, M7, and M9 vehicles to consumers. Mr. Zhang stressed that this collaboration leverages the strengths of both companies, creating new technological advantages.

According to the automaker’s financial report, in 2023, SERES invested 4.438 billion yuan in R&D, which accounted for 12.38% of its operating income. As of the end of 2023, the company had 4,955 R&D personnel, marking an 18.6% increase compared to the previous year.

Waymo and Uber (NYSE: UBER) announced an upgraded strategic partnership: The two parties plan to deploy at least 1,200 Robotaxi units in the Middle East by 2027, covering three major markets—Abu Dhabi, Dubai, and Riyadh. According to the plan, all 1,200 Robotaxi units will be integrated into the Uber App to provide public transportation services.

Tesla Vice President Tao Lin stated today that Tesla would actively participate in related work on assisted autonomous driving in the Chinese market, but could not yet provide a clear timeline for implementation. Elon Musk previously indicated that Tesla's Full Self-Driving (FSD) would be deployed in Europe this February, with the Chinese market to follow.

On February 5, Changan Automobile unveiled its global sodium-ion battery strategy, and the world's first mass-produced sodium-ion battery passenger vehicle was officially introduced. Test data shows that the vehicle equipped with CATL's sodium-ion battery delivers nearly three times the discharge power compared to conventional lithium iron phosphate vehicles with the same battery capacity under -30°C conditions. In extreme cold environments of -40°C, it maintains over 90% capacity retention, and it can still discharge stably even at the extreme low temperature of -50°C.
